Signs Your Chula Vista Business Needs Heating Repair

Heating system issues often start small before escalating into major failures. Recognizing the early warning signs can help you avoid a complete system breakdown and costly emergency repairs. If you notice any of the following, it’s time to consult a professional technician:

  • Inconsistent Heating and Cold Spots: Are some offices freezing while others are too warm? Uneven heating is a classic sign of problems ranging from thermostat malfunctions to blocked ductwork or failing components.
  • Strange Noises: Your commercial heater should operate with minimal noise. Banging, clanking, grinding, or high-pitched squealing sounds indicate serious mechanical problems that require immediate attention.
  • Unusual Odors: A strong burning smell, the scent of fuel, or musty odors circulating through your vents are significant red flags. These smells can indicate anything from a dirty filter to a dangerous electrical fault or gas leak.
  • Sudden Increase in Energy Bills: If your utility costs have spiked without a corresponding change in usage, your heating system is likely working inefficiently. Worn-out parts or a struggling system must work harder, consuming more energy to produce the same amount of heat.
  • System Fails to Turn On or Cycles Frequently: A heater that won’t start or one that turns on and off repeatedly (short-cycling) points to issues with the ignition system, thermostat, or electrical connections.

Comprehensive Repairs for All Commercial Heating Systems

Chula Vista's commercial landscape features a wide variety of buildings, each with unique heating requirements. Our veteran-operated team has decades of combined experience servicing, diagnosing, and repairing the complex systems that keep these properties running. We have the expertise to handle any issue with any type of commercial heating equipment.

Our technicians are proficient in repairing:

  • Rooftop Packaged Units (RTUs): As the most common type of commercial HVAC system, we have extensive experience diagnosing and fixing all RTU issues, from faulty compressors and fan motors to refrigerant leaks.
  • Commercial Furnaces (Gas & Electric): We handle everything from pilot light and ignition control problems in gas furnaces to failing heating elements and sequencers in electric models.
  • Commercial Boilers: Our team is equipped for expert boiler repair, addressing issues like kettling, leaks, pressure problems, and pump failures to ensure your hydronic heating system is safe and efficient.
  • Commercial Heat Pumps: We can resolve common heat pump problems, including refrigerant charge issues, reversing valve failures, and defrost cycle malfunctions.
  • Variable Refrigerant Flow (VRF) Systems: We provide specialized service for advanced commercial VFR HVAC systems, addressing complex communication errors, electronic expansion valve issues, and inverter board failures.
